Description
3D printed phased array antennas (PAA) would be more rugged, lighter and take a variety of shapes and including unmanned aerial vehicle (UAV) wings. Printing antennas, passives and interconnects has been demonstrated in 3D printing. Using printed electronic approaches for printing Field Effect Transistors (FET) has been demonstrated and including printing switches in the GHz regime. The challenge is to combine these similar but disparate techniques to print active switches in PAAs. This proposed effort will utilize micro-dispensing, also known as direct printing, to print the entire PAA. Demonstrations of a printed FET as well as printing to bare die will be done in Phase I and a path to show the cost savings and the feasibility of printing a full PAA in Phase II.
